Kraken Launches xStocks Vaults That Let Depositors Earn Yield on Tokenized Stocks

Kraken has opened three vaults that pay variable yield on tokenized stocks SPYx, QQQx and NVDAx while depositors keep their price exposure. The strategy borrows stablecoins against the tokenized shares on Solana's Kamino lending markets, and Kraken flags smart-contract, liquidity and liquidation risks alongside the reward.

Kraken has launched three vaults that let eligible clients earn variable yield on SPYx, QQQx and NVDAx while retaining exposure to the tokenized equity or ETF they deposited. The xStocks vaults display an estimated net APY of 2% for SPYx and QQQx and 1.8% for NVDAx at launch. Kraken charges a 25% performance fee on vault earnings, and the displayed rate is already net of that fee.

How the Yield Is Generated

When a client allocates an eligible xStock, Kraken sends it to an embedded self-custodial wallet on Ink, wraps it for vault accounting, and deposits it into a Veda vault. Sentora designed the strategy and acts as risk manager, while Veda supplies the vault infrastructure.

Sentora then bridges the wrapped xStock to Solana and posts it as collateral in Kamino lending markets, where the strategy borrows stablecoins against the position and deploys them into selected DeFi strategies. Returns are swapped back into the deposited xStock, so a SPYx holder accrues more SPYx rather than cash or stablecoins.

The launch extends xStocks beyond trading. In March, xChange enabled cross-chain trading for more than 70 tokenized stocks across Ethereum and Solana, and the new vaults initially cover only SPYx, QQQx and NVDAx. As of launch, the xStocks platform reported over $800 million in assets under management.

A Fee, a Waiting Period and Added Risk

Deallocation can be requested at any time, but Kraken returns the xStocks to a client's balance after a three-day waiting period. Kraken lists smart contract, liquidity, bad-debt, liquidation, cross-chain execution and downstream-asset risks; if xStock collateral falls significantly or withdrawal demand rises sharply, positions may need to close quickly, and losses are shared proportionally among vault users. Rewards are not guaranteed, and the product is not covered by a government or bank protection program.

Kraken's risk disclosure says xStock holders have no voting rights, distribution entitlements or legal claim to the underlying stock, and they carry operational and credit risk tied to Kraken, issuer Backed and the institutions holding the backing assets. At launch, the vaults are available in the European Economic Area and other supported markets, but not in the U.S., UK, Canada, Australia, UAE or sanctioned countries.
